Classic digital blackjack

Classic RNG blackjack titles keep the focus on fundamentals: hit, stand, double, split, and sound bankroll management. They’re ideal if you prefer a quick pace, minimal distractions, and consistent decision-making hand after hand.

Live-dealer blackjack

Live blackjack is built for players who want the atmosphere of a real table — without leaving home. In a live-dealer format, you typically get:

  • Human dealers on camera and a studio or casino-like environment
  • Real-time gameplay with a steady, table-paced rhythm
  • Community feel through shared tables and an authentic presentation
